History
Date of Birth: February 24th, 1993
Home: Pierre Part, Louisiana, United States
Family: Henry (Hank) and Melissa Elliott (parents), Hunter (older brother)
Death: Personal Tragedy (born in a small town outside New Orleans, she always exhibited a natural poetic talent, though she was also very emotional and easily overwrought, later diagnosed as about midway on the autism scale; she immersed herself in poetry, her own and others', and would go onto to win state-wide poetry contests; but as she hit her teen years, a deep depression took over and she ultimately committed suicide by walking into Lake Verret, drowning herself like Virginia Woolf), 2006
Mentor: Peter Randou
The Test: Trial by Knowledge (Lakemen who dwelled in the Shadowlands around and in that lake Reaped the girl, and they took her under wing to teach her the basics of the afterlife and the secret to Transcendence through their aquatic-focused doctrine; she didn't really buy into it but was grateful for their help)
Comrades: Seymour Wightman, Honey Elwin, Melia Garner, Rodney Merrick, Tybalt Peverell, Kiera Portman, Aileen Gray, Kynley Gray
Key Event #1: Awe & Wonder (she wandered the Shadowlands in search of poetic inspiration, finding the Underworld tragically beautiful; by luck, on numerous occasions she avoided all variety of hazards in her absent-minded travels)
Transition: Shift in Purpose (then she ran into Seymour Wight; she recognized him immediately for who he really was, but played it calm and cool despite being one of his biggest fans; conversely, she won him over with her sense of serenity and peace that hid the haunting memories she still acutely suffered of her own self-inflicted death)
